As far as you have similar ECU connectors, like MY99/00 to convert to STi v5/v6 PowerFC, the wiring mod. is quite easy to perform :
2 sensors wires have to be inverted, plus another to be wired to the MAF temp. sensor...

I will have a hunt and see if it is the same, but for 99-00 cars the difference between sti and uk is the cam/crank sensors are different. On mine and others i have fitted (also 99-00) I didn't modify the pin positions but swapped the wiring from one plug to the other at the sensor end.
